What is the cheapest Abu Dhabi to the United States flight route?

Data is based on round-trip flight searches on KAYAK over the past month.

The cheapest ticket to the United States from Abu Dhabi found in the last 72 hours was to Atlanta, at AED 3,368 return. The most popular route is from Abu Dhabi (AUH) to New York John F Kennedy Intl Airport (JFK), and the cheapest round-trip airline ticket found on this route in the last 72 hours was AED 3,608.

Can I save money by flying with a stopover from Abu Dhabi to the United States?

The average return price for all direct flights, flights with one stopover, and flights with two stopovers for the route found by users searching on KAYAK in the last 2 weeks.

No, with an average price for the route of AED 4,868, prices are generally cheapest when you fly direct.

What is the cheapest month to fly from Abu Dhabi to the United States?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from Abu Dhabi to the United States,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from Abu Dhabi to the United States is July, when tickets cost AED 3,063 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are August and November, when the average cost of return tickets is AED 5,697 and AED 4,672 respectively.

What’s the cheapest day of the week to fly from Abu Dhabi to United States?

The average price of all round-trip flights from Abu Dhabi to the United States clicked on KAYAK for each day over the last 12 months.

If your flying dates are flexible, you should consider flying to United States on a Tuesday, as we generally find the cheapest rates on that day for this route. On the other hand, Thursday is the most expensive day to fly from Abu Dhabi to United States. For your return ticket, we recommend flying on a Wednesday and avoiding Sundays for the best deals.

How far in advance should I book a flight from Abu Dhabi to the United States?

To calculate weekly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each week before departure over the last year for round-trip flights from Abu Dhabi to the United States,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each week.

To get a below-average price on a flight from Abu Dhabi to the United States, you should book around 4 weeks before departure, which saves you about 26% compared to booking last-minute.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 26 weeks before departure.
